Maîtrisez l’Agilité pour Réussir PMP en toute sérénité

L'agilité en gestion de projet

Nous continuons notre série en route vers la certification PMP. Après avoir bien exploré les 9 domaines du PMBOK V6, où nous avons retrouvé tous les processus essentiels, nous avons abordé des concepts clés qui comptent pour une part importante de votre note. Aujourd’hui, nous allons aborder un sujet crucial qui a été ajouté lors de la transition entre le PMBOK V6 et le PMBOK V7 : l’agilité en gestion de projet. Cette évolution marque un tournant majeur dans la façon dont un chef de projet est perçu. En effet, avec le PMBOK V7, le chef de projet n’est plus simplement un technicien de projet, mais devient une personne ayant une vue globale et holistique du projet, un recul nécessaire pour naviguer efficacement dans les environnements complexes.

L’importance de l’agilité en gestion de projet

Dans cet épisode, nous allons explorer les tenants et aboutissants de l’agilité en gestion de projet, une approche devenue indispensable pour les gestionnaires modernes. Un chef de projet doit maîtriser les concepts agiles et savoir comment choisir la méthodologie la plus adaptée en fonction du contexte et des spécifications de son projet. Nous allons aussi examiner comment cette évolution s’intègre dans la certification PMP et comment elle vous aide à gérer vos projets agiles, tout en vous permettant de répondre aux besoins changeants du client.

L’agilité, telle qu’elle est abordée dans le PMBOK V7, n’est pas simplement une méthode, mais une véritable posture et culture de gestion de projet. Cette approche est particulièrement pertinente dans le contexte des projets informatiques où l’environnement évolue rapidement, avec des concurrents nouveaux et des besoins changeants. En informatique par exemple, attendre que le développement d’un produit soit terminé pour se rendre compte qu’il est obsolète et ne répond plus aux besoins du client est une situation que l’agilité permet d’éviter. Il est donc impératif de choisir une méthodologie agile, capable de répondre aux défis d’un marché en perpétuelle évolution.

Créer de la valeur au cœur des projets agiles

L’un des éléments les plus importants de cette méthodologie est la notion de valeur. En agilité en gestion de projet, chaque projet doit créer de la valeur, qu’il s’agisse de valeur financière, commerciale ou même d’optimisation écologique. Si le projet ne répond pas à ces objectifs, alors il perd sa raison d’être. C’est là que l’agilité se distingue des autres approches, en mettant l’accent sur la création de valeur à chaque étape du processus. En mode agile, on ne mesure pas uniquement si un livrable a été livré, mais si ce livrable est réellement utile et utilisé par les utilisateurs finaux.

Les pratiques agiles et leur mise en œuvre

Les méthodes agiles offrent une approche itérative et incrémentale qui repose sur des cycles de travail courts appelés sprints. Ces sprints permettent de livrer des morceaux fonctionnels du produit à intervalles réguliers, d’obtenir des retours d’utilisateurs, et de réajuster le tir pour maximiser la valeur délivrée. Le processus est flexible et permet d’intégrer des changements tout au long du projet, ce qui est essentiel dans des environnements complexes et incertains. Ce type d’approche itérative s’inscrit dans une démarche d’amélioration continue où l’équipe agile évolue constamment pour améliorer la qualité et la pertinence de ses livrables.

La gestion de projet agile repose sur plusieurs principes clés, tels que l’amélioration continue, la priorisation du backlog produit, et la livraison en incréments fonctionnels. Le rôle des équipes agiles est d’intégrer les utilisateurs dans la boucle de validation, assurant ainsi que chaque livrable crée de la valeur. Cela repose sur un principe fondamental de l’agilité en gestion de projet : la collaboration entre les parties prenantes pour une meilleure gestion des attentes et des exigences.

Scrum : un cadre méthodologique agile

Le Scrum, une des méthodologies agiles les plus populaires, illustre bien ces principes. Dans Scrum, l’équipe de développement, qui comprend de 7 à 9 personnes, travaille de manière autonome, avec un Product Owner qui est responsable de la définition de la valeur et de la priorisation des tâches, et un Scrum Master qui facilite le travail de l’équipe en éliminant les obstacles. Ce rôle de facilitateur agile est central dans la gestion de projet agile. Le Scrum Master aide à faire avancer l’équipe et assure que les bonnes pratiques sont respectées pour maximiser la productivité et la collaboration au sein de l’équipe de développement.

Un autre élément essentiel est l’utilisation de Jira, un outil visuel qui permet aux équipes de suivre l’avancement du projet de manière fluide. Grâce à Jira, il est possible de visualiser l’état des user stories, de suivre les progrès du projet agile, et d’assurer que les équipes de développement respectent les délais et les priorités définies. Jira facilite également la gestion du product backlog et permet de visualiser les sprints et leurs résultats.

Obtenez gratuitement notre kit !

Des fiches actionnables pour réussir votre certification PMP.

Choisir la bonne méthodologie pour le projet

L’un des défis majeurs dans la gestion de projet agile est de savoir choisir la bonne approche en fonction des circonstances. Par exemple, si vous travaillez dans un environnement bien défini, avec des spécifications claires et un périmètre précis, un modèle prédictif en cascade pourrait être plus adapté. En revanche, si le périmètre du projet est flou et que vous devez constamment vous adapter aux besoins des utilisateurs, une approche agile est nécessaire pour rester flexible et réactif face aux changements.

Le passage d’un modèle classique à une approche agile est parfois difficile pour certaines entreprises, notamment celles habituées à des méthodologies de gestion de projet plus rigides. Cependant, l’agilité, avec son cycle itératif et son focus sur l’amélioration continue, permet aux projets de s’adapter au fur et à mesure de leur avancement. Il ne s’agit pas seulement d’une question de méthodes, mais aussi de culture organisationnelle. Adopter l’agilité en gestion de projet implique de repenser la manière dont les équipes collaborent, comment elles prennent des décisions et comment elles ajustent leurs priorités en fonction des retours utilisateurs et des besoins émergents.

La transformation vers l’agilité : un atout stratégique

Les démarches agiles sont donc essentielles pour garantir que les projets ne sont pas seulement menés à bien, mais qu’ils créent réellement de la valeur. Dans un environnement où les exigences sont souvent changeantes, où les délais sont serrés et où la réactivité est cruciale, l’agilité permet de se maintenir à flot et de réussir à livrer des produits qui répondent réellement aux attentes des clients.

Enfin, la méthodologie agile, et plus particulièrement la méthode Scrum, place le chef de projet dans une position stratégique, non seulement pour coordonner les efforts des équipes, mais aussi pour prendre des décisions éclairées sur la direction du projet. Cela nécessite une compréhension approfondie des pratiques agiles et de la manière dont elles peuvent être appliquées de manière optimale dans le cadre d’un projet agile.

L’agilité est une méthodologie de gestion de projet qui va au-delà de simples outils ou processus. Elle nécessite une transformation de la culture organisationnelle et de la façon dont les projets sont gérés et livrés. Ceux qui maîtrisent l’art de l’agilité en gestion de projet sont ceux qui réussiront à créer des projets qui apportent une valeur réelle et mesurable, tout en répondant rapidement aux changements et aux besoins des utilisateurs.

Dans les prochains épisodes, nous approfondirons d’autres aspects de la gestion agile de projet, en vous donnant les clés pour maîtriser cette approche et la mettre en œuvre de manière efficace dans vos propres projets.